### Step 6 — Deploy the Lookaway Autocomplete Widget

After the bundle builds, push it to the widget CDN bucket and purge the edge cache. The Lookaway address autocomplete widget won't load on partner sites unless the manifest is signed, so confirm the build output includes `manifest.sig`. If it's missing, rerun the pipeline with signing enabled rather than signing by hand. For manual recovery only, sign with the key that follows.

deploy key for kajof-fajop: bky6_gDHw9Q

Ticket: Staging env misconfigured for Siftgate bloom filter

The bloom layer in front of the Pellet KV store is rejecting all lookups in staging because the env file was copied from the dev template without credentials. False-positive tuning values are fine; only the auth line is missing. To unblock the weekly demo, the Pellet admission secret must be set on the following line.

env line for yaguf-fajop: LEDGER_TOKEN13=fb08984397349

So, dates. Daybreak formats every timestamp through the locale service, and when someone in the Velmora region sees "03/04" meaning April 3rd when they expected March 4th, this is the page you want. First, confirm the user's locale is actually set — the default fallback is en-generic, which causes most complaints. Second, check that the format catalog deployed with the current release matches the locale service version. Third, don't edit catalogs by hand. The locale service currently runs with these settings.

service settings:
[casax]
port = 6379
team = rusir
host = casax.zemvarhq.corp
region = outer-4
access_code = ac_9808ce
timeout_ms = 1500

Finance Review Summary — Harwick Division

Following the quarterly review, a hiring freeze is in effect for the Harwick division through year-end. Open requisitions are paused; offers already extended will be honored. Sales targets are unchanged, and commissions are unaffected. Quota coverage will be managed through territory consolidation. The broader reasoning for this measure is set out in the confidential note below.

board note of bawep-tajef: Queniusek Systems plans to raise the Quenvan list price by 53.1 percent in March. The pricing group signed off on a budget of $176.4 million for Project Drueth. The renewal with Casionix Partners closes at $142.5 million a year, 8.3 percent below the last contract. Project Fraax slips by six weeks because of the tooling delay.